Frequently Asked Questions about Outer 95 North Middlesex
How much are Studio apartments in Outer 95 North Middlesex?
There are currently 130 Studio Apartments in Outer 95 North Middlesex with rent ranges from $1,550 to $5,891 with an average price of $2,416.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Outer 95 North Middlesex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Outer 95 North Middlesex ranges from $1,295 to $10,772 with an average monthly rent of $2,878.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Outer 95 North Middlesex c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Outer 95 North Middlesex range from $1,995 to $13,552.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,548.
How expensive are Outer 95 North Middlesex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 58 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Outer 95 North Middlesex on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$950 to $11,753 - averaging $4,238 for the location.
